Monitor your blood oxygen level and heart rate effortlessly with our app and sync your Apple Watch to get alerts about low levels.* Are you worried about your oxygen levels dropping or wondering how your activities affect your blood oxygen? Our app makes it easy to track these vital signs wherever you go. Track and log your vital signs to share with your doctor later, or stay informed about your cardiovascular health with curated articles—all in one app. But hang on, there's more: • Take an oxygen test effortlessly, and conveniently record and monitor your data. • Use your phone’s camera to estimate your heart rate and then easily log your data afterward. • Sync and store your data in Apple Health or retrieve your blood oxygen and heart rate readings from Apple Health. • Log and easily export your blood oxygen and heart rate data into PDF to share with your doctor. • Regain your calm after a stressful experience by practicing box breathing, all within the app! • Receive sleep reports to assist you in achieving your sleep goals. (requires an Apple Watch Series 3 or later with watchOS 8) *Please be aware that to receive push notifications regarding changes in your blood oxygen level or heart rate, you will need an external device such as a pulse oximeter or a smartwatch.
